Description

Druckluftmaschine. Es ist häufig erforderlich, das zum Betrieb von Druckluftmotoren bestimmte Druckmittel höher zu verdichten, als es im Motor verwendet wird. Das in einem Vorratsbehälter aufgespeicherte, hochgespannte Druckmittel wird in solchem Falle in einem Druckminderventil auf den gewünschten Arbeitsdruck von niedrigerer Spannung gebracht, wodurch jedoch ein erheblicher Teil der in dem hochgespannten Druckmittel enthaltenen Energie nutzlos verloren geht. Es ist schon vorgeschlagen worden, diesen Energieverlust dadurch zu verringern, daß das expandierende Druckmittel Luft oder Gas von niedrigerer Spannung in einem Inj ektor ansaugt und auf den gewünschten Arbeitsdruck verdichtet.Compressed air machine. It is often necessary to operate the Air motors compress certain pressure medium higher than it used in the engine will. The high-tension pressure medium stored in a storage container is in such a case in a pressure reducing valve to the desired working pressure of brought lower tension, which, however, a significant part of the in the high tension Energy contained in pressure medium is uselessly lost. It's already suggested been to reduce this energy loss in that the expanding pressure medium Air or gas of lower tension is sucked into an injector and at the desired point Working pressure compressed.

Die Anwendung eines solchen Inj ektors bei unter Tage arbeitenden Druckluftmotoren ist jedoch im allgemeinen deswegen nicht ohne weiteres möglich, weil durch die von außen angesaugte Grubenluft viel Schmutz in die Zylinder des Motors kommt, der einen großen Verschleiß zur Folge hat.The use of such an injector for those working underground In general, however, air motors are not easily possible because of this, because the pit air sucked in from the outside causes a lot of dirt to get into the cylinders of the Motor comes, which has a great deal of wear and tear.

Die vorliegende Erfindung vermeidet diesen Nachteil und ermöglicht die Anwendung eines Injektors dadurch, daß das im Motor bereits wirksam gewesene Druckmittel wieder angesaugt und nochmals verdichtet wird, so daß also dieser Teil des Druckmittels einen Kreislauf durchmacht.The present invention avoids this disadvantage and enables the use of an injector in that what has already been effective in the engine Pressure medium is sucked in again and compressed again, so that this part of the pressure medium goes through a cycle.

Da andererseits bei unter Tage arbeitenden, mehrstufigen Motoren das aus der Niederdruckstufe austretende Druckmittel dazu verwendet wird, die warme Grubenluft durch zwischen die einzelnen Stufen des Motors eingeschaltete Zwischenerwärmer hindurchzusaugen, so ist es vorteilhaft, einen Teil des aus der Hochdruck-oder auch einer Zwischenstufe austretenden Druckmittels im Inj ektor anzusaugen und wieder zu verdichten. Hierbei ergibt sich noch als besonderer Vorteil ein besserer Wirkungsgrad des Injektors, da in diesem Falle ein kleineres Verdichtungsverhältnis zu überwinden ist.On the other hand, with multi-stage engines working underground that from the low pressure stage exiting pressure medium is used to the warm Pit air through intermediate heaters connected between the individual stages of the engine to suck through it, it is advantageous to take some of the high pressure or also an intermediate stage to suck in exiting pressure medium in the injector and again to condense. A particular advantage here is a better degree of efficiency of the injector, since in this case a smaller compression ratio has to be overcome is.

Die Vorrichtung kann auch sinngemäß bei anderen unter oder über Tage arbeitenden Motoren sowie auch für Gase und Dämpfe Anwendung- finden.The device can also be used analogously for others underground or above ground working engines as well as for gases and vapors.

PATENT CLAIMS: i. Engine driven by compressed air, mainly for compressed air locomotives, the high-tensioned power medium of which expands without mechanical work to the working pressure suitable for the engine and thereby sucks in air of lower tension in an injector and compresses it to the working pressure, characterized in that the air sucked into the injector is completely or partially taken from the fuel that has already been effective in the engine, so that this part of the fuel goes through a cycle. Multi-stage engine according to Claim i, characterized in that the air sucked into the injector is taken from the high-pressure stage or from an intermediate stage of the engine.
